Job Description

Cloud Computing has transformed the IT landscape, becoming a cornerstone of corporate digital transformation strategies. This field involves migrating traditional IT activities, such as file storage, servers, and applications, to a virtual environment. Cloud computing specialists design, implement, and manage scalable cloud-based solutions, ensuring businesses achieve operational efficiency, cost savings, and flexibility.

Skills Involved

1. Technical Proficiency:
• Expertise in cloud platforms like AWS, Microsoft Azure, and Google Cloud Platform (GCP).
• Knowledge of virtualization technologies, containerization (e.g., Docker, Kubernetes), and serverless computing.
• Proficiency in scripting languages like Python, Bash, or PowerShell.
2. System Architecture Knowledge:
• Designing and deploying cloud-based solutions tailored to organizational needs.
• Understanding networking, databases, and storage systems in cloud environments.
3. Problem-Solving and Analytical Skills:
• Identifying system inefficiencies and recommending improvements.
• Ensuring the robustness and security of cloud environments.
4. Collaboration and Communication Skills:
• Working with cross-functional teams, including customer service, analysts, and project managers.
• Conveying techn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
5. Adaptability and Continuous Learning:
• Staying updated with emerging cloud technologies and trends.
• Managing multi-cloud and hybrid cloud environments.

Career Opportunities

1. Cloud Engineer: Implements and manages cloud infrastructure and solutions.
2. Cloud Architect: Designs comprehensive cloud strategies and infrastructure for enterprises.
3. DevOps Engineer: Focuses on automation, CI/CD pipelines, and integration in cloud environments.
4. Cloud Security Specialist: Protects cloud systems from cyber threats and ensures compliance.
5. Cloud Consultant: Advises businesses on migration, optimization, and cost-effective cloud solutions.
6. Data Engineer: Builds data pipelines and architectures using cloud platforms.
7. Systems Administrator: Manages and maintains cloud-based servers and networks.
8. Software Developer: Designs cloud-native applications and integrates them with cloud services.
